| Key Question | Why It Matters | What to Plan For |
|---|---|---|
| Who will perform the electrical work? | Ensures the project is handled by licensed and experienced professionals | Hire a licensed electrical contractor with new construction experience |
| Will the system support modern power use? | Modern homes require more electricity for appliances and devices | Plan for at least a 200 amp service and future expansion |
| Will the electrical work meet safety codes? | Electrical codes prevent hazards and ensure safe installations | Follow local building codes and schedule required inspections |
| How many outlets and circuits are needed? | Proper outlet placement prevents overload and improves convenience | Add dedicated circuits for large appliances and enough outlets for each room |
| What future features should be included? | Planning early avoids costly upgrades later | Consider EV chargers, smart home wiring, and energy efficient lighting |
| What is the electrical project timeline? | Electrical work happens in phases during construction | Plan rough wiring, fixture installation, and inspection schedules |

Question six, what is the timeline for the electrical project
Electrical work happens in stages
Most new construction electrical work happens in stages. First electricians install rough wiring inside the walls. Later they install outlets, switches, and fixtures.
The electrical contractor manages these steps during the electrical project.
Scheduling inspections
Inspections are required during different phases of the installation. These inspections confirm the electrical work meets safety standards.
